Message type: E = Error
Message class: BT - Background processing messages
Message number: 889
Message text: All standard jobs are already scheduled

- All standard jobs are already scheduled ?The SAP error message BT889, which states "All standard jobs are already scheduled," typically occurs in the context of background job scheduling in SAP. This message indicates that the system has reached the limit of scheduled jobs for a particular job class or that the jobs you are trying to schedule are already in the queue. Causes: Job Class Limitations: Each job class in SAP has a predefined limit on the number of jobs that can be scheduled simultaneously. If this limit is reached, you will encounter this error. Existing Scheduled Jobs: The jobs you are trying to schedule may already be scheduled in the system, leading to this error. System Configuration: The system may be configured in such a way that it restricts the scheduling of additional jobs under certain conditions.
